Authorities seek man who fled I-35 rollover wreck

Authorities are asking for the public’s help in locating a man who they believe fled on foot from the scene of a rollover wreck on Interstate 35 near Kyle Wednesday while injured.

Jeff Barnett, Kyle Police Chief, said emergency officials were dispatched around 4 p.m. to a multi-vehicle collision along northbound I-35 just south of Center Street. Details of the wreck, which involved a turned over SUV, are unknown at this time. It is also unknown how many vehicles were involved in the incident. However, Barnett said there were no reported injuries.

When authorities arrived on scene, witnesses told them a man, who they believe operated one of the vehicles in the wreck, fled the scene on foot in a westerly direction and ran across all lanes of southbound I-35, Barnett said. The man then ran into pasture on the west side of I-35 before going into a wooded area.
